๐ Budesonide Nasal Spray 100 mcg/dose โ As Licensed
๐ Description:
Budesonide 100 mcg/dose Nasal Spray is a topical intranasal corticosteroid used for treating and managing nasal inflammation caused by allergic and non-allergic rhinitis, and for preventing nasal polyp recurrence after surgery.
๐งพ Prescription / Uses:
Indications:
- Allergic rhinitis (seasonal/perennial)
- Non-allergic rhinitis
- Nasal polyps
- Supportive therapy for sinusitis
Dosage:
- Adults & Children (as per brand instructions):
Typically 1 spray (100 mcg) into each nostril once or twice daily
Maximum daily dose should not exceed 400 mcg/day, unless directed by a physician
Route: Intranasal only
๐ฌ Nature:
- Pharmacologic Class: Corticosteroid (Glucocorticoid)
- Mechanism: Inhibits inflammatory cytokines and mediators; reduces mucosal edema, nasal congestion, sneezing, and itching
- Onset: Initial symptom relief within 12โ24 hours; full effect may take 3โ7 days of regular use
๐ Advantages:
- High-potency dose for moderate to severe nasal inflammation
- Provides effective long-term symptom control
- Local action with minimal systemic absorption
- Lower incidence of sedation and systemic side effects compared to oral steroids

โ ๏ธ Precautions:
Contraindications:
- Known hypersensitivity to Budesonide or spray ingredients
- Active nasal infections (bacterial, viral, fungal)
Caution in:
- Children under 12 years (check brand-specific age limit)
- Recent nasal surgery or trauma
- Immunocompromised individuals
- History of glaucoma, cataracts, or tuberculosis
Side Effects:
- Dry nose or throat
- Nasal irritation, burning, or epistaxis (nosebleeds)
- Headache
- Rare: Septal perforation, nasal candida infection
๐ฉโโ๏ธ Patient Advice:
- Use at the same time each day
- Blow your nose gently before spraying
- Do not sniff hard after application โ let medication settle
- Avoid contact with eyes
- Clean nozzle weekly to prevent clogging
- Do not exceed the recommended dose
- If no improvement after 7โ10 days, consult your doctor
- Use under medical supervision in children, elderly, and during pregnancy
